Associate

Barry Harris is an Associate at the firm. Mr. Harris brings a wealth of medical knowledge from his prior career as a Neurosurgical Nurse Practitioner. Mr. Harris offers a unique perspective to clients as he has been on both sides of the table in medical malpractice depositions and can use that experience to assist his clients in their deposition and trial preparation. His practice areas include medical malpractice and health care litigation, general/civil litigation, and commercial litigation. Mr. Harris is licensed to practice in Maryland and the District of Columbia.

Mr. Harris received an undergraduate degree in Speech Communications with an emphasis in pre-law from Northern Arizona University in 1994. He then went on to obtain a Diploma in Nursing. Mr. Harris graduated with his Bachelor of Science in Nursing in 2001 and his Master of Science in Nursing in 2002, both from Johns Hopkins University. Mr. Harris obtained his Juris Doctorate degree from the University of Baltimore, cum laude, in 2015.

Mr. Harris joined Gleason, Flynn, Emig & McAfee, Chartered in May 2019.
